Also, please note that the directory, /www/www.apache.org/dist/jakarta/
would be resync-ed everyday into mirrored-sites and /www/archive.apache.org/dist/jakarta/ (without *delete*). Once
you put something, they won't be deleted @ mirrored and
archive.apache.org sites.
